Christmas Spiced Protein Chocolate Truffles

This time of year is notorious for copious amounts of food and drink. These truffles are chocolatey and sweet with a hint of Christmas. They're also protein packed, vegan (if you forego the white chocolate drizzle and WPI) and gluten free. Go to town.

  • Prep 10 min
  • Cook 10 min
  • Serves 20
Christmas Spiced Protein Chocolate Truffles

Ingredients

  • 0.25 cup sunflower seeds
  • 0.25 cup almonds
  • 4 dates
  • 3 tablespoon Raw Cacao WPI or Cacao & Cinnamon Plant Protein - Raw Cacao WPI
  • 3 tablespoon Organic Raw Peruvian Cacao - Organic Raw Peruvian Cacao
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la
  • 1 teaspoon mixed spice
  • 0.5 teaspoon cinnamon
  • 0.25 teaspoon nutmeg
  • 2 tablespoon coconut oil
  • 1 tablespoon water
  • pinch sea salt
  • 1 tablespoon Organic Raw Peruvian Cacao - Organic Raw Peruvian Cacao
  • 1 teaspoon allspice
  • 1 tablespoon white chocolate, melted

Directions

  1. Add the almonds and sunflower seeds to the food processor and blitz for one minute.
  2. Next, add the remaining ingredients, and blitz thoroughly until the ingredients have combined and formed a ball.
  3. Using your hands, roll little truffle sized balls of the mixture. I made about 20.
  4. Once you have rolled them all, pop them in the fridge. If you are coating them in the spiced-cacao coating, mix together the cacao and spice, and roll each truffle in the mixture.
  5. If you are feeling extra fancy, drizzle them with the melted white chocolate. You could also add a few drops of peppermint extract or freeze dried raspberries to the truffle mix for extra festivity feels. They keep well in the fridge or freezer in an airtight container.
